TEACHER AS HEALER:
How to Create a School Culture of Wholeness, Wellness, and Peaceful Living Paperback – August 29, 2022
TEACHER AS HEALER is
designed for all spiritually- and peace-oriented elementary school
teachers, parents, school psychologists, and principals of all faiths.
It acknowledges, gently and universally, a Higher Power—the Creator of
all that exists, of all that we teach and learn about.
This book
aims to cultivate upright human behavior and peaceful living in our
schools, homes and society. In a world rife with widespread conflict,
both inner and outer, violence and war, this book empowers educators and
parents to make a positive impact by fostering a culture of wellness.
It advocates for a soul-centered, therapeutically informed approach to
education that nurtures the whole person—physically, emotionally,
socially, mindfully, and spiritually.
To accomplish the above, TEACHER AS HEALER
offers practical tools and teaching strategies within a brilliant,
holistic, and all-inclusive educational framework that incorporates
everything one teaches, from the macrocosm to the microcosm. This book
also reveals a suggested curriculum program that you can emulate to show
how your teaching can be plugged into it. It is an essential teaching
resource with worksheets and a practical curriculum guide, offering
beneficial programs, ‘therapeutic’ tools, charts, pictures, and helpful
teaching and learning strategies for children to joyfully learn best,
and for teachers to heartfully teach best.
Emphasizing the urgent need to reclaim spirituality in our educational system, TEACHER AS HEALER guides readers on how to gently and universally
integrate spirituality and consciousness into their educational
practices. It offers many practical ways to embed upright universal
spiritual values, virtues, ethics, unity, loving-kindness, respect for
differences, conflict resolution, humane relationships, and ecological
awareness into one's curriculum, along with 7 Universal Principles of
Upstanding Human Conduct known as the 7 Noahide Laws. All these elements
are essential for enhancing our relationships with ourselves, others,
society, and the world around us. All are essential to help bring Heaven
down to Earth.
The foundation of TEACHER AS HEALER
is the author’s doctoral research at McGill University, recognized on
the Dean's Honor List for its potential positive impact on our youth and
society. This research underscores the book's comprehensive approach to
integrating spiritual and therapeutic elements into education, making
it an invaluable resource for fostering holistic development and a
culture of peaceful living.
